
From the Organizer
The Creek Trail Creek Crusher is back for 2026! The Crusher has 3 races designed to test your endurance and will. 6, 12, and 24 hour races will begin at 8:00 am on November 15th at Rotary Park in Paragould, AR. The race route begins at Rotary Park and proceeds to the 8 Mile Creek Trail, the entire route is completely paved with no street crossings. All Races will be last participant standing events, meaning if a race has no participants complete the entire time allotted for their race, once only one participant remains the race ends, and the last participant standing is declared the winner. If multiple participants reach the final cycle in their respective race the first to complete the cycle will be declared the winner.
Runners will be required to complete a 4.167 mile out and back cycle within 59 minutes and 59 seconds. A new cycle starts at half past every hour. Early and late starts are not permitted. If a runner has not returned from the previous cycle or is not at the start line when the new cycle begins, they will be disqualified. If medical aid is required on the course the runner will be disqualified. Runners are permitted to have teams/ nutrition/ hydration/ aid available in the designated area provided at the start/finish line. Hydration packs and fuel are allowed on the course. Lunch and dinner will be provided for participants at the start/finish line.
We are honored to announce proceeds from the 2026 Creek Trail Crusher will be directed to support the Paragould Police Department.
